two.1.4) Short description

The University Short Course Programme (USCP) forms a part of a wider strategy of the Services to contribute to the education of its personnel.

The USCP offers personnel the opportunity to study from a broader perspective, issues of current importance and interest to the military and be exposed to new and diverse ideas alongside developing research, analysis, reasoning and critical thinking skills, all within an academic environment and to encourage further study on an individual basis.

It is the Authority's intention is to select the highest scoring suppliers who will be invited to tender providing they meet the overall score of a pass within the PQQ. If a supplier receives a fail to any question within the PQQ, they will automatically fail the evaluation and not be invited to participate further.
